If you are struggling with hunger and are pregnant or the mother of young children, the WIC program is an option. WIC stands for Women, Infants, and Children and provides an EBT card to purchase healthy food such as eggs, cheese, whole grains, milk, fruit, and vegetables. They can also offer referrals to local services. Other Paths to Adoption in Tallahassee

Private adoption is not your only choice. Foster care can be an option as well. Under certain circumstances, such as, a baby is born exposed to substances, foster care could be made mandatory by the Florida Department of Children and Families. Generally, in these cases, the parent does not get to say who the baby is placed with.

Kinship or relative adoption is a third choice. If there is a family member who is generally blood-related to the child and who is interested in adopting, they can petition to adopt your child. This can be a great solution, but consider all aspects of this choice. Your relative may be under the impression they are just stepping in for a period of time, or you may have to deal with some boundary issues.

Adoption Attorneys in Tallahassee

In Tallahassee, you will need to hire an adoption attorney, even if you are working with an adoption agency. This is important because Florida Adoption laws must be followed completely, and all paperwork filed with the courts. Home Study Services in Tallahassee

Home study services are available through Lifetime Adoption for adoptive families in the Tallahassee area. A home study is required whether you choose domestic or foster adoption. A home study includes financial and employment verification, a home visit, background checks, along mandatory education hours required by the state of Florida.

To complete your home study, you will need to gather your required documents such as:

  • Health statements from your medical professional that attests to your mental and physical well-being
  • Five written references from friends, co-workers, or others that know you and can indicate their belief in your readiness to be an adoptive parent.
  • Financial statements. These will include pay stubs, tax returns, profit and loss statements, and any other supporting documents.
  • Autobiographical letters that indicate why you are adopting and what your beliefs are regarding marriage, parenting, and any other hopes and dreams
  • Background checks – anyone in the home who is over the age of 12 will need a local, state, and federal background check.
  • A home study social worker will visit your home and interview members of the household to gather information on your home environment. This is completed to verify that you have a safe place to raise a child and will be presented to the judge at finalization.

    Another Florida requirement is education hours. You can access educations resources at Lifetime via articles, classes, podcasts, and webinars. The state requirement in Florida is twelve hours of education.

Finalization of Adoption at Court in Tallahassee

Your adoption will be finalized in the courts as your last step to complete the adoption.

According to Tallahassee, Florida mandates, this will happen no less than 90 days from taking custody of the baby. You will have a home visit within one week of the placement and will then meet with your social worker once a month until three visits are completed.

Your adoption attorney will file the legal paperwork with the courthouse. A hearing date will be set in Tallahassee at the Leon County Circuit Court. The judge will review all of your home study and all adoption documentation. Once satisfied, the final decree of adoption will be issued. Time to celebrate!

Tallahassee International Adoption Agencies

International adoption is another way to adopt. There are sometimes stories on the news about orphans in other countries struggling, and some feel the call to adopt these orphans. It is imperative to work with an adoption agency that has solid experience in international adoption. Each country has its own unique laws and requirements that must be followed. The country’s current political and social climate can have an effect on the adoption process.

The nations in Africa, China, and Eastern European countries tend to be the most popular countries for international adoption. Popular agencies that specialize in international adoption are:

Foster Care Adoption in Tallahassee

In addition to domestic and international adoption, foster to adopt is another way to adopt. With foster adoption, you will go through the Florida Department of Children and Families and complete the necessary steps to qualify as a foster family:

  • Attend a mandatory foster parent orientation.
  • Complete the foster parent education required by the state. Have a fingerprint-based background check.
  • Complete your mandatory home study to prove you are able to foster a child.

AdoptUSKids is an additional way to adopt through the foster care system. There are waiting children from Florida and other states. Adoptive families must have a completed their home study and all other requirements the state mandates completely.

You will find foster care adoption usually involves children with special needs and older children. The cost of adoption can be lower, and the time needed to adopt can be shorter than domestic adoption or international adoption.
